高效管理存储资源:文件系统配额设置指南

时间:2024-12-18

在现代计算环境中,文件系统配额的设置是一项至关重要的任务,它能够帮助系统管理员高效地管理存储资源,确保系统的稳定性和安全性。文件系统配额允许管理员为用户或用户组设置存储限制,从而防止单一用户占用过多的存储空间,影响其他用户的正常使用。本文将详细介绍如何在不同的操作系统中设置文件系统配额,以及如何通过配额管理来优化存储资源的使用。

理解文件系统配额

在深入探讨如何设置文件系统配额之前,我们首先需要理解文件系统配额的基本概念。文件系统配额通常包括两个主要部分:块配额(Block Quotas)和文件数配额(Inode Quotas)。块配额限制了用户或用户组可以使用的磁盘空间总量,而文件数配额则限制了用户或用户组可以创建的文件数量。

Linux系统中的配额设置

在Linux系统中,文件系统配额的设置通常涉及以下几个步骤:

  1. 挂载选项:确保文件系统在/etc/fstab中以支持配额的方式挂载,通常需要添加usrquotagrpquota选项。

  2. 创建配额数据库:使用quotacheck命令来创建或更新配额数据库文件。

  3. 设置配额限制:使用edquota命令来设置用户的块配额和文件数配额。

  4. 启用配额:使用quotaon命令来启用配额。

  5. 监控和报告:使用repquota命令来生成配额使用报告,以监控配额的状态。

Windows系统中的配额设置

在Windows系统中,文件系统配额的设置通常通过以下步骤完成:

  1. 文件服务器资源管理器:打开“文件服务器资源管理器”,这是Windows Server中的一个工具,用于管理文件服务器和存储资源。

  2. 配额管理:在“文件服务器资源管理器”中,选择“配额管理”,然后可以为特定的卷设置配额模板。

  3. 创建配额模板:创建一个配额模板,定义配额限制和警告级别。

  4. 应用配额模板:将配额模板应用到目标文件夹或卷,以实施配额策略。

  5. 监控和报告:Windows Server提供了一个配额报告功能,可以用来监控配额的使用情况和生成报告。

最佳实践

在设置文件系统配额时,以下是一些最佳实践:

  • 合理规划:在设置配额之前,应该对用户的存储需求进行评估,以确保配额的合理性。

  • 渐进式限制:可以逐步实施配额限制,先设置警告阈值,然后再逐步收紧限制。

  • 定期审查:定期审查配额的使用情况,根据需要调整配额限制。

  • 用户教育:向用户解释配额的目的和重要性,以及如何管理他们的存储空间。

结论

文件系统配额的设置是存储资源管理的重要组成部分。通过合理设置配额,系统管理员可以确保存储资源得到高效利用,同时也能够防止存储空间被过度占用。无论是Linux还是Windows系统,都有相应的工具和策略来实现这一目标。遵循最佳实践,定期审查和调整配额策略,可以帮助组织维持一个健康、高效的存储环境。